Aluminum wire (especially if it’s soft temper) can be overly soft and too easily bent for making sturdy rings. In my local craft store, most of the aluminum wire in the jewelry aisle is soft temper. (Most of it is also colored aluminum, and the color comes off the wire easily.)

Rings tend to take more of a beating than any other jewelry item, since people use their hands all day long. So you want to be sure – especially if you sell your jewelry – that the materials and construction of your rings are able to take a bit of being banged around during the normal course of being worn.

Here’s a great way to develop a feel for the best wires to choose (and avoid) for different projects:

I recommend that you get small amounts of a few different kinds of jewelry wire, in different metals, gauges, and hardnesses – and play with them with your various jewelry tools.

As you experiment and play with each kind of wire, test what each kind of wire can do, can’t do, and how well the finished pieces hold their shape.

You really will get a good feel for the different wire options this way, especially if you jot down a few notes about your testing of each type of wire.

By: Rena Klingenberg https://jewelrymakingjournal.com/easy-folded-wire-ring-tutorial/comment-page-2/#comment-26665 Mon, 30 Sep 2013 18:11:35 +0000 http://jewelrymakingjournal.com/?p=16354#comment-26665 Hi Kendall! My finished rings are pretty sturdy and not easily bent.

I just want to make sure – you’re not using Artistic Wire / craft wire for these rings, right?

Because that’s pretty flexible wire, and might not hold up as well for these rings. I recommend brass, copper, sterling silver, or other jewelry wire for these rings.

You might also try using half-hard wire and see if that makes a difference for you.

By: Gayle https://jewelrymakingjournal.com/easy-folded-wire-ring-tutorial/#comment-5850 Thu, 04 Oct 2012 10:42:33 +0000 http://jewelrymakingjournal.com/?p=16354#comment-5850 Wire is probably my favourite jewellery making medium and I can never go past a tutorial about wire rings. These are totally gorgeous! I read something really interesting somewhere that I thought I might share. Because our fingers are not round, a nice round ring is sometimes difficult to get on over the knuckle if it has to then fit your finger. To remedy this, squeeze it so that the ring becomes slightly oval. When you put your ring on, turn it 90 degrees so that the longer oval part fits over your knuckle (which is usually wider than it is high). Once past the knuckle, turn the ring back 90 degrees and it will fit on the skinny part of your finger but won’t slip off over the knuckle. So simple, but so effective!

Jennifer, I have used both soft and half-hard wire. If you can form the wire into the shapes you want with the half-hard wire, that’s probably a sturdier choice. But if the half-hard is too difficult to shape, then I’d go with the soft wire.

Zoraida, I love hearing about your experiences with making, selling, and wearing rings like this. One thing that I love about these is that they’re totally adjustable. My fingers tend to be different sizes throughout the day (swelling / shrinking a bit), and I find adjustable rings so much more comfortable than ones that are just one size.

I think adjustable rings are also easier to sell, because they can fit a variety of fingers! πŸ™‚
